Book Learning

1 July 2009

This Berryman's a moralistic thing:
its jacket has been lit, man rolled back to ma
and shot with liverspots like extra moons
or doctored film of UFOs -

blinked, I think, by a student in the bath
who, before Returns, checked the title page with '??°a marche?
Oui' (knowing a book so used would not reply);

and who, for all his troubles, failed
to notice a label still stuck fast across the blurb
and faded to its price code, W. O. E.

About Bonny Cassidy


Bonny Cassidy is a poet, lecturer at the University of Wollongong, and researcher for The Red Room Company. In 2008 she completed a PhD on the poetry of Jennifer Rankin and Jennifer Maiden, and she has published on these poets, Gwen Harwood and other aspects of Australian poetics. Bonny travelled to Japan as an Asialink literature fellow in 2008 and her first chapbook will be appearing later this year through Puncher & Wattmann.
